Best 76903 Texas Private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 3 private schools serving 295 students in 76903, TX (there are 9 public schools, serving 4,366 public students). 6% of all K-12 students in 76903, TX are educated in private schools (compared to the TX state average of 6%).
100% of private schools in 76903, TX are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Baptist).
